Abstract :
A novel low-temperature co-fired ceramic (LTCC) dual-band bandpass filter with compact size is reported. By using three semi-lumped resonators, not only the upper passband frequency can be conveniently tuned, but also the transmission zeros generated between the two passbands can be easily controlled by the elements of each resonator. A 2.5/5.2GHz dual-band experimental filter has been designed and fabricated to verify the proposed design concept. Based on the vertically-folded structure and LTCC technology, the filter only occupies an area of 5.1 × 4.6 × mm2.
